IRB Infrastructure on Saturday said its toll revenue in February 2026 rose 22 per cent year-on-year to Rs 746 crore. The toll revenue in February 2025 was at Rs 614 crore, IRB said in an exchange filing. The toll revenue includes earning of IRB InvIT Fund (Public InvIT) and IRB Infrastructure Trust (Private InvIT). The newly added IRB Harihara Tollways (TOT 17) in Uttar Pradesh contributed its full month toll revenue of February 2026 at Rs 52.8 crore. Of the total 24 toll assets, IRB MP Expressway in Maharashtra contributed the major share of Rs 148.2 crore to the total revenue collection in February 2026, up from Rs 140.9 crore a year ago. Contribution of IRB Ahmedabad Vadodara Super Express Tollway rose to Rs 79.7 crore in February 2026 from Rs 63.9 crore a year ago, which is the second largest in the total toll collection. With Rs 73.7 crore, IRB Golconda Expressway (Hyderabad ORR) was the third largest contributor to the total revenue in February 2026, up from Rs 65.2 crore

IRB Infrastructure and Developers (IRB) has posted a 12 per cent year-on-year rise in its toll revenue to Rs 754 crore in December 2025. The revenue collection stood at Rs 675 crore in the same month last year, IRB said in an exchange filing on Wednesday. The collection includes revenues from two of its InvITs, namely IRB InvIT Fund (Public InvIT) and IRB Infrastructure Trust (Private InvIT), the company added. Of its total 24 assets, IRB MP Expressway in Maharashtra contributed the major share of Rs 170.3 crore to the total revenue collection in December 2025, up from Rs 163.4 crore in December 2024. Contribution of IRB Ahmedabad Vadodara Super Express Tollway rose to Rs 84.1 crore in December 2025 from Rs 70.7 crore a year ago, the second largest in the aggregate toll collection, the filing said.
